场景:工作需要监控多个服务器的相同指标(手动一个个加太耗费人力了,就写了个不那么自动但有效的小脚本)
一、先绘制一个图表(定义模板,根据这个模板用脚本复制)
二、导出这个图表(生成json文件)
三、根据模版编辑批量制作其他图表。
在导出的json文件中找到aliasColors这个标签,然后折叠起来,如下图复制。然后找个在线压缩json的网站 把它压缩成1行。
保存到一个文件。template.txt
然后把想批量导入的机器hostname保存成一个文件,hostname.txt
制作脚本就如下了,很简单。
这里h w x y为我来进行替换。